Promathilda (Teretrina) bolinoides
Taxonomy
Promathilda (Teretrina) bolinoides was named by Haas (1953). It is a 3D body fossil. Its type locality is Cerro de Pasco area, Ninacaca, loc. 86, which is in a Rhaetian marine limestone in Peru.
